AUSTIN, TEXAS Ceces Veggie Co., an Austin-based maker of riced and spiralized vegetables, has received investment from former Whole Foods Market co-chief executive officer Walter Robb. Financial terms were not disclosed.Launched in 2015, Ceces offers a range of refrigerated organic vegetables and meal kits featuring noodled beets, zucchini, sweet potato, butternut and yellow squash, and riced broccoli and cauliflower. Ceces products are available at Whole Foods Market and Sprouts stores nationwide and at Target, Kroger, Albertsons, Safeway and other regional retailers.
